What is WiMax?
WiMax is an industrial forum that promotes deployments of Broadband Wireless Networks It supports IEEE801.16 family of standards Certify interoperability of products and technology Global drive for acceptance of broadband wireless

UL Burst Profile
Each UL burst profile includes:
Modulation type (QPSK, 16QAM, 64 QAM) FEC Code type Last codeword length Preamble length (16 or 32) Scrambler seed (15 bit)
